Dungariya is a Rural village located in Mahidpur, Ujjain, Madhya-pradesh.

The total population of Dungariya is 1,178.

Dungariya village comprises 231 households.

The literacy rate in Dungariya is 49.2%. Among the literate population of 491, there are 317 literate males and 174 literate females.

In Dungariya, there are 591 males and 587 females, with a sex ratio of 993 females per 1000 males.

There are 181 children (15.4% of population), comprising 84 boys and 97 girls.

The total number of workers in Dungariya is 591, with 587 main workers and 4 marginal workers.

In Dungariya, there are 314 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(158 males, 156 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).

Dungariya is located in Madhya-pradesh state, Ujjain district, and falls under Mahidpur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 471311 and LGD code is 471311.
